The Ultimate Buying Guide: Choosing the Best Glass Drill Bit

Drilling into glass can feel intimidating. However, with the right tool, you can create clean holes for DIY projects, home decor, or repairs. Glass is hard and brittle, so you need a specialized bit to get the job done safely. This guide will help you choose the best drill bit for your next glass project.

1. Key Features to Look For

When shopping for glass drill bits, look for a “spear-point” or “diamond-tipped” design. These shapes help the bit bite into the smooth surface without slipping. A good bit should also have a sturdy shank that fits securely into your drill chuck. Some bits include a pilot point, which helps keep the drill steady when you first start the hole.

2. Important Materials

Glass is much harder than wood or metal. Standard steel bits will fail immediately. You must use bits made with industrial-grade diamond grit or tungsten carbide. Diamond-tipped bits are the gold standard. They grind through the glass slowly rather than cutting it. This material choice prevents the glass from cracking under pressure.

3.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Several factors determine how well your bit performs:

  • Cooling Capability: Friction creates intense heat. High-quality bits work best when used with water to keep the temperature low.
  • Coating: Bits with a thick layer of diamond dust last much longer than cheap, thin-coated alternatives.
  • Shank Design: A precision-ground shank reduces vibration. Less vibration means a smoother hole and less chance of the glass shattering.
  • Storage: Bits kept in protective cases stay sharp longer because the diamond grit does not get damaged.

4. User Experience and Use Cases

Using a glass drill bit is a slow process. You should never force the drill. Let the weight of the tool do the work. Common use cases include drilling holes in glass bottles for fairy lights, creating custom mirrors, or making holes in glass tabletops for wiring. Always place your glass on a flat, padded surface like a piece of plywood. This prevents the glass from flexing and breaking.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can I use a regular drill bit for glass?

A: No. Regular bits are designed for wood or metal. They will slide off the glass or cause it to shatter instantly.

Q: Do I really need to use water while drilling?

A: Yes. Water acts as a lubricant and coolant. It prevents the glass from overheating and helps the bit last longer.

Q: How fast should my drill speed be?

A: Use a slow speed. High speeds create too much heat and increase the risk of cracking the glass.

Q: Should I drill all the way through at once?

A: No. It is best to drill halfway, then flip the glass over and finish the hole from the other side. This creates a cleaner edge.

Q: How many holes can I drill with one bit?

A: A high-quality diamond bit can drill dozens of holes if used correctly with water. Cheap bits may dull after only one or two uses.

Q: How do I stop the bit from “walking” or slipping?

A: Use a small piece of painter’s tape over the spot where you want to drill. This gives the bit a better grip.

Q: Is it safe to drill tempered glass?

A: No. Tempered glass is designed to shatter into tiny pieces if it is compromised. Do not attempt to drill it.

Q: How much pressure should I apply?

A: Apply very light, steady pressure. If you push too hard, you will crack the glass.

Q: Can I use a cordless drill for this task?

A: Yes, a cordless drill works perfectly. Just make sure the battery is fully charged so you have consistent power.

Q: What should I wear for safety?

A: Always wear safety glasses. Glass dust and small shards can fly into your eyes during the drilling process.
